Output ef4cd179b075ad283ed10276c7c1e32eb2990a2c735767becfbb2c6e6720a157:0

value
18846580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ec4b80f55861cd314fc938940f57d135e9556e5b OP_EQUALVERIFY OP_CHECKSIG
address
LgmNBaRXTQETz8ypMS212P3jMhCEvMk5eL
transaction
ef4cd179b075ad283ed10276c7c1e32eb2990a2c735767becfbb2c6e6720a157
spent
true